Description (last modified by ryandesign (Ryan Carsten Schmidt))

The new Xcode 6.3's clang 6.1 (3.6.0svn) compilers break the bootstrap of FSF gcc 4.9.2 and gcc 4.9.3svn due to configure leaving BUILD_CONFIG unset.

https://gcc.gnu.org/bugzilla/show_bug.cgi?id=65733
https://llvm.org/bugs/show_bug.cgi?id=23192

This same issue occurs when the llvm 3.5.1, 3.5.2 or 3.6.0 compilers are used to bootstrap gcc. The current workaround is to explicitly pass --with-build-config=bootstrap-debug to configure when the newer clang compilers are in use.

Just to be clear, this is considered a defect in both llvm.org and Apple clang so no hack will be forthcoming from the FSF gcc developers. Upstream lllvm.org needs to eliminate this regression in the improper setting of the CIE version in the absence of debug flags.

Replying to sears3@…:

So basically no gcc version can be compiled until it's handled upstream? Effectively, new installs of macports are not happening for a while then (as I just figured out). Anybody have a hack/workaround?

No. You just have to explicitly pass '--with-build-config=bootstrap-debug' to configure when building with the clang 3.5 or later from llvm.org or with Apple clang 6.1. The code in configure that tests for proper debug code in object files is tripped up by this breakage in clang (where the wrong CIE version of dwarf 3 is emitted in the absence of debug flags).

Corroborated a comment on GCC PR bootstrap/65733 that gcc48 is also affected. gcc47 @4.7.4_3 and gcc5 @5-20150405 are not.
